Не меняется яркость экрана ASUS TUF Gaming A15 FA506NF

Установлены кеды. При нажатии Fn+F7/Fn+F8 на экране отображается всплывашка, градусник демонстрирует изменение яркости, но самого изменения не присходит. Похожая ситуация с ползунком в "Яркость и цвет".

Из интересного:

dmesg | grep -i backlight
[    2.743088] amdgpu 0000:05:00.0: amdgpu: [drm] Skipping amdgpu DM backlight registration
[    7.049962] asus_wmi: using asus-wmi for asus::kbd_backlight

Апдейт: так - работает.

xrandr --output <your_output_name> --brightness 0.5

Куда копать?...
https://wiki.archlinux.org/title/Backlight#Kernel_command-line_options
🖥 AsRock B550M Pro4 :: AMD Ryzen 5 3600 :: 16 GB DDR4 :: AMD Radeon RX 6600 :: XFCE
💻 ACER 5750G :: Intel Core i5-2450M :: 6 GB DDR3 :: GeForce GT 630M :: XFCE
alien175
https://wiki.archlinux.org/title/Backlight#Kernel_command-line_options
Ни один вариант не помог: либо контрол яркости пропадает, либо демонстрирует визуал полноценной работы, но фактически яркость не меняется.
OSKiller
amdgpu: [drm] Skipping amdgpu DM backlight registration
BBS + PATCH

Плюс нейросеть:
Сообщение «amdgpu: [drm] Skipping amdgpu DM backlight registration» может появляться в логах ядра и указывать на отказ использования встроенной подсветки для amdgpu.
Возможная причина проблемы - использование параметра командной строки ядра acpi_backlight=vendor. В этом случае не будет использоваться родная подсветка для amdgpu.
Для решения проблемы можно попробовать изменить параметр командной строки ядра, например, использовать значение idle=nomwait. Также можно проверить, обновлена ли версия UEFI BIOS.
Ошибки не исчезают с опытом - они просто умнеют
в 6-тых кедах управление через ddcutil сделали, а в ноутах через acpi обычно
ddcutil detect глянь что даёт, может у тебя просто он не установлен
OSKiller
При нажатии Fn+F7/Fn+F8
я применю light — a program to control backlight controllers
cat /sys/class/backlight/acpi_video0/brightness
2
light -A 5
cat /sys/class/backlight/acpi_video0/brightness
3
light -U 5
cat /sys/class/backlight/acpi_video0/brightness
2
Ошибки не исчезают с опытом - они просто умнеют
vasek
BBS
Иксы стартуют, работают все функциональные клавиши, кроме изменения яркости...

vasek
PATCH
В ядре уже присутствует...

vasek
acpi_backlight=vendor
acpi_backlight=native

grayich
ddcutil detect глянь что даёт
ddcutil detect
Invalid display
I2C bus: /dev/i2c-2
DRM connector: card0-eDP-1
EDID synopsis:
Mfg id: CMN - Chimei Innolux Corporation
Model:
Product code: 5409 (0x1521)
Serial number:
Binary serial number: 0 (0x00000000)
Manufacture year: 2020, Week: 1
This is a laptop display. Laptop displays do not support DDC/CI.

Invalid display
I2C bus: /dev/i2c-11
DRM connector: card0-eDP-1
EDID synopsis:
Mfg id: CMN - Chimei Innolux Corporation
Model:
Product code: 5409 (0x1521)
Serial number:
Binary serial number: 0 (0x00000000)
Manufacture year: 2020, Week: 1
This is a laptop display. Laptop displays do not support DDC/CI.

vasek
cat /sys/class/backlight/acpi_video0/brightness
2
light -A 5
cat /sys/class/backlight/acpi_video0/brightness
3

Но яркость при этом отстаётся неизменной.
У Вас, если я не ошибаюсь дискретка GeForce RTX 2050. Естественно ноут работает пока в гибридном режиме (видюхи меняются в зависимости от нагрузки). Драйвера для встроенной видео может работать не совсем корректно. А что если установить ещё и для nvidia проприетарный драйвер? В ноуте переключить принудительно на дискретку и посмотреть что будет. По крайней мере програмно регулировка яркости должна заработать через nvidia settings.

P.S. На сайте nvidia нашёл вот это:
Driver Version:570.133.07
Release Date:Tue Mar 18, 2025
Operating System:Linux 64-bit
Language:Русский
File Size:375.77 MB
OSKiller
acpi_backlight=native
пробуй это
acpi_osi=! idle=nomwait acpi_backlight=native

PS - и пробуй ЭТО
Ошибки не исчезают с опытом - они просто умнеют
rutgerg
для nvidia проприетарный драйвер?
Его и юзаю...
 
Зарегистрироваться или войдите чтобы оставить сообщение.